Recent research has uncovered a surprising and crucial connection between obesity prior to conception and an increased risk of autism spectrum disorder (ASD) in children. This revelation is more than just science—it’s a wake-up call for all hopeful parents aiming to create the healthiest path to parenthood.
A groundbreaking study reported by New Atlas reveals that it’s not only the health during pregnancy that matters but significantly the health status before pregnancy that can epigenetically program autism risks. Researchers found that obesity in mothers before conception triggered epigenetic changes in eggs — essentially gene switches — that influence brain development linked to autism-like behaviors (source).

How Can You Take Control?
If you’ve been struggling with fertility or are just starting your journey to parenthood, the good news is that proactive steps can make a real difference. Here are some empowering tips:
- Prioritize a Healthy Weight: Achieving and maintaining a healthy weight before trying to conceive can help reduce risks associated with obesity.
- Adopt a Nutrient-Rich Diet: Focus on whole foods rich in antioxidants, vitamins, and minerals to support egg quality and overall reproductive health.
- Stay Active: Moderate exercise not only helps manage weight but also enhances hormonal balance and boosts fertility.
- Manage Stress: High stress affects your body’s balance; incorporate mindfulness, yoga, or other stress-relief methods.
